Surprise borders Sun City West and Sun City Grand, and that shapes the local training market — a large share of the work here is manners and leash skills for adult adopted dogs rather than puppy classes, because a lot of West Valley dogs come home to retirees as second or third dogs. Where else can I find a dog trainer near Surprise?
Peoria is about 8 miles east and Glendale about 12 miles southeast, both with more trainers listed. Phoenix, roughly 21 miles away, has the largest selection in the metro and is where you will find most specialists — reactivity, scent work, service-dog training. For weekly group classes the drive matters; for a one-off consult it usually does not.
What kind of training suits an adopted adult dog?
Ask trainers directly whether they work mainly with puppies or with adult dogs, because the approaches differ and not every trainer does both well. For an adopted adult, the useful early work is usually loose-leash walking, recall, and settling in the house — not obedience competition skills. A trainer who asks about the dog's history before quoting a package is the one to book.
How does West Valley heat affect training schedules?
It compresses outdoor sessions into early morning for a third of the year. Surprise runs hotter than central Phoenix, and from June through September pavement is unsafe for paws well before mid-morning. Ask whether a trainer has indoor space for summer, or expect 6 a.m. sessions — a trainer who has not solved this will simply cancel through the hottest months.
